Vehicle Fire Closes Portion Of Rt. 78 In Hunterdon County A vehicle fire shut down a portion of Route 78 in Hunterdon County on Wednesday afternoon, Nov. 22. The vehicle went up in flames on the eastbound side east of exit 11 to CR 614/Pattenburg Road in Union Township around 2:45 p.m., according to 511NJ. Two of three right lanes were closed, causing delays of around 10 minutes. Victim Extricated, Hospitalized In Sparta Crash One person was extricated and taken to a nearby hospital following a late night crash in Sparta on Tuesday, Nov. 21, authorities said. The Sparta Township Fire Department responded to the crash on Woodport Road near Mara Boulevard just after 12 a.m. Crews rescued the trapped victim in under eight minutes, they said. The victim was then taken to a nearby hospital for further treatment.

Driver Runs Off Road, Hits Tree In Serious Warren County Crash: State Police A driver was seriously hurt after crashing into a tree in Warren County on Tuesday afternoon, Nov. 21, state police said. A Honda was heading southbound on Route 519 south near milepost 33 in Harmony Township when the vehicle ran off the right side of the road, into the woods, and struck a tree around 4:05 p.m., NJSP Detective I Jeffrey Lebron told Daily Voice. The driver, a 57-year-old White Township woman, was taken to a nearby hospital with serious injuries, Lebron added. The crash remains under investigation. No further details were released.
